Sales Strategy & Planning Year-Round Intern
Job Description Summary
The Strategy & Planning Intern supports the CS&E Team with sales activation activities, executing the Annual Operating Plan (AOP), and helping the team achieve business goals. Responsibilities include maintaining internal reports using Microsoft Office applications, Power BI, and other internal systems; scheduling and coordinating meetings, samples, and product cuttings; and assisting with any other project needs or ad hoc requests.
